Hazardous materials can pose which health hazards?

Explanation:
Hazardous materials can cause a broad range of health effects, not just mild symptoms. When someone is exposed, substances can displace or dilute oxygen leading to asphyxiation, or injure the skin and eyes causing chemical burns and tissue destruction. Some agents are carcinogenic, meaning they can contribute to cancer over time, and highly toxic materials can be deadly with sufficient exposure. This spectrum covers both immediate, acute injuries and longer-term serious health risks, which is why the answer listing asphyxiation, chemical burns, tissue destruction, cancer, or death best represents what hazardous materials can pose in real-world settings, such as in a correctional environment where various chemicals and agents may be encountered. Temporary skin irritation or nausea may occur with certain substances, but they don’t capture the full range of serious health hazards, and saying there are no health hazards is simply incorrect.
